2024 Summer Internship - Human Resources - HR Analytics - RemoteRequisition ID: 127990Location:Phoenix, AZ, US, 85004-2121Category: InternShare this JobDescription:Freeport-McMoRan (FCX) is a leading international mining company with headquarters in Phoenix, Arizona. FCX operates large, long-lived, geographically diverse assets with significant proven and probable reserves of copper, gold, and molybdenum.Freeport-McMoRan’s internship program has been referred to as one of the top programs in the mining industry. By providing access to top minds and technology in mining today, our structured internship will provide you the skills and experience to help prepare you for a successful career. Our internship program is tailored to full-time students currently enrolled at an accredited four-year university and recent graduates in North America. Internships are temporary full-time paid positions and typically run from May through August.Please note: At the sole discretion of the company, this position has the possibility to work remotely up to 100% of the time from anywhere within the United States, except California, Connecticut, Illinois, Kentucky, Massachusetts, Michigan, New Hampshire, New York, Oklahoma as well as other states based on business factors. This position may require occasional travel to the Phoenix corporate offices and/or site locations throughout the United States.DescriptionUnder general supervision, assists the HR Analytics team with various projects that benefit the HR organization.
